Jennifer Conley

Was OK. Rolls were the star, some of the best rolls ive ever had, but they should be complimentary, not $5, for the price of entrees I feel like the bread could be free. "Seared" Scallops could have used a little more sear, "charred" brussels could have used a little more char, Gnocchi was surprisingly overcooked given that the rest of my dish was undercooked. Raw oysters were good-ish- not the restaurant's fault, but there was not much meat in them. Fish and chips was just OK, worth $12 not $23 got 3 little pieces that was mostly breading, not crispy, and a handful of undercooked wedges. Cocktail I had was ok (Mass Appeal) but too sweet and too big for an Aperol and champagne cocktail, who puts ice in a champagne cocktail? being a former mixologist, I was too embarrassed for the bartender to even take a pic of it. I expected something smaller and more bitter. Service was great. Brian did a great job. Atmosphere was super loud, but that's not the restaurants fault either, it's a small shotgun type place and the table next to us were very loud and rude and ran our server to death leaving him not much time to tend to his other tables, which was OK with us, we are easy. Music they played was good, early 2000s. We didnt complain and tipped 35%, but we won't be back. Not too bad but not very good overall. I would pass on it and go to Brooklyn&Butcher for a true Downtown New Albany date night, which we love, and will happily spend $200 for a meal. I know it's the same owners. Good try though, guys.
